Ghost

Add letters toward a real word—but avoid being the person who finishes it.Classics & remixes · JoyRiders rules edition

HOW TO PLAY

Start here.

YOU’LL NEEDNothing
  1. 1Starting with no letters, move around the group in order. On each turn, add one letter to the end of the spoken fragment; say the full fragment aloud so everyone hears it.
  2. 2The fragment must be capable of starting a real word with at least four letters, but the player may not complete such a word. A player who completes a valid word loses the round.
  3. 3Before adding a letter, a player may challenge the person who added the previous letter. That person must name the real word they were building. If they cannot, they lose the round; if they can, the challenger loses it.
  4. 4The round loser takes the next letter in G-H-O-S-T and starts a new fragment.
  5. 5With three or more players, spelling GHOST eliminates that player; the last player wins. With two players, the first person to spell GHOST loses.
